| Entrez Gene summary for BAG5: The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the BAG1-related protein family. BAG1 is an anti-apoptotic protein thatfunctions through interactions with a variety of cell apoptosis and growth related proteins including BCL-2,Raf-protein kinase, steroid hormone receptors, growth factor receptors and members of the heat shock protein 70 kDafamily. This protein contains a BAG domain near the C-terminus, which could bind and inhibit the chaperone activity ofHsc70/Hsp70. Three transcript variants encoding two different isoforms have been found for this gene. protein sequence)Recommended Name: BAG family molecular chaperone regulator 5 Size: 447 amino acids; 51200 Da
Subunit: Binds to the ATPase domain of HSP/HSC70 chaperones. Binds PARK2 (By similarity)
